One completely assembled Fire Pit made from three cast iron segments, one stainless steel Vertical Pole, one brass Fastener Tool, one cast iron Cooking Grate, one cast iron Fire Grate, one adjustable height Pole Clamp, one Grate Hook and one pair of heat resistant gloves.

The Sherman Cooker ships complete in one box and weighs approximately 117 pounds. The box has four carrying handles to make the package easier to handle.

The Fire Pit segments and Cooking Grate are solid cast iron, as found with professional cookware.  They will never burn through like fire pits made from sheet metal. The Cooking Pole and the adjustable pole clamp are 304 stainless steel, and the Fastener Tool is solid brass. All of the hardware is 304 stainless steel.

The Fire Pit has a durable baked enamel finish and the Cooking Grate is seasoned just like a cast iron pan, with Flaxseed oil.

The Fire Pit can be cleaned as needed to preserve the appearance, but cleaning is just for aesthetics.  Animal fat and cooking debris left on the Cooking Grate will protect it from the elements. If you choose to, the Cooking Grate can be gently cleaned with a typical wire grill brush after each use. If brushed clean, we highly recommend that you apply a thin layer of cooking oil to the Cooking Grate for protection.

Always perform this step on a COLD cooker with NO hot embers present.

All wood fires create smoke. The key to a “smoke-less” fire is a hot fire with plenty of airflow using dry, seasoned hard wood. The OSC has been designed with Ventilation Flues in the base of the Fire Pit to enable a hot fire that will radiate throughout a large area. With periodic cleaning of the ash, the Ventilation Flues should never restrict the flow of air. The OSC can produce a hot and near “smoke-less” fire with the proper fuel and minimal maintenance.

The Original Sherman Cooker burning dry wood produces very little ash, but like all fires it will require occasional cleaning. We recommend removing the Cooking Grate and tipping the Fire Pit on its side to allow for easy access to shovel the ash. 

Always perform this step on a COLD cooker with NO hot embers present.

The components are made, assembled and shipped from Inner-Tite Corp. in Holden, Massachusetts.  The cast iron Fire Pit segments and Cooking Grate are made by Victoria Cookware in Medellín, Colombia. Victoria Cookware has been making high-quality cast-iron components since 1939.
